Article summary

Andrew McCalip announced the synthesis of LK99, a significant milestone in his project. The announcement was made on Twitter, where McCalip shared a video of the process. The synthesis of LK99 is a crucial step in the development of new materials with unique properties. McCalip's project has garnered significant attention and interest on social media.
